FEDERAL Information Minister Sherry Rehman has resigned from her office, reported private TV channels late on Friday night.
Quoting sources, the channels reported that the minister tendered her resignation after differences over control on media. She took the step during a meeting at Aiwan-i-Sadr under the chair of President Asif Zardari.
However, the sources said Prime Minister Yousuf Raza Gilani has not accepted her resignation.
Meanwhile, presidential spokesman Farhatullah Babar has denied any such development, saying "The Minister has not submitted resignation."
